Iconic 02:51 PM 03-07-2019
Originally Posted by O.city:
Devils advocate, but he's got eli wobble launching balls out there.

If you put him with Mahomes, what would be put up?
Hill has a career reception percentage, meaning the amount of catchable targets he's reeling in, at 71.5%. That's two years of Alex included. OBJ is at 64.7%

Outside of his rookie season OBJ has never been at or above 70%.

The best part is both Hill and Odell have had a season where they were both targeted 129 times. Odell caught 91 balls for 1,305 for 12 TDs and Hill caught 87 balls for 1,479 for 12 TDs.

Hill is more explosive, even with Alex fucking Smith throwing him the ball, and he's a whole lot more valuable as a result.
